There are several ways in which you can boost your creativity and use it to bring changes to the world.
1. Give yourself time
It doesn’t matter if you are not doing anything for days, weeks or months. It does not mean that your mind is blocked and you cannot do anything now. If no idea is crossing your mind at certain times there is nothing to worry about. It is perfectly fine because our brain also needs rest and sometimes it takes a long time to get back on track.
2. Observe
As Aristotle has put a lot of stress on the concept that everything is an imitation of another thing that is already present in this world. This concept is true somehow as we gain ideas from the things we see in our daily life and then use those things in our art, writing or anything we are going to do. It is very important to observe every minor occurring around you so that you can get ideas and understand the reasons behind it.
3. Think deeply
This is one of the most important things you should do if you want to boost your creativity. Think beyond the limits. Don’t just look at things at surface level and let them go. Remember the things that excite you and think about them in your free time and try to gather more details about it. Deep thinking is very important in any field you are interested in.
4. Focus
Keep your focus on your work. If you are focusing on your creativity then there is nothing that can stop you. Losing focus is equal to losing direction. To enhance your creativity you have to focus even on small things. It is important to maintain your focus on your goal.
5. Take small breaks
It is not necessary to always pressurize yourself. Sometimes breaks are important. Your brain also needs rest. If you are always indulge in any work then there will a time when you will be fed up of everything. Little breaks in your work helps you to not lose interest.
6. Meditate
Meditation is something that boosts your brain cells. Take a few minutes from your day and try to meditate and stretch your body. It releases your stress and helps you to think more positively.
7. Long walks
Long walks give you a chance to interact with more things. It helps you to explore the world and open up your mind. Spending time in nature and enjoying fresh air is definitely very helpful for a healthy mind and body.
8. Socialize
Socializing is very important in boosting up your creativity. It is believed that the more people you meet the more knowledge you get. Meet your friends and spend some time with your family to have deep conversations with them. Talk about your ideas and listen to their ideas. Having meaningful conversation with others enhances the capability of your own mind. There is possibility that you will get to know something that you did not know before.
9. Don’t be afraid to try something new
There are a lot of people who are afraid of being wrong and because of this fear they are not able to experiment. Sticking to the same old traditions is of no help if you want to become more creative. Look for changes, search for what new and different you can do.
10. Perfection is a myth
Running after perfection is not helpful at all. If you are continuously stressing yourself to create something exceptional then you are not going to create anything at all because it raises fears and leaves you with the thought that you cannot use your thoughts and ideas anywhere.
11. Don’t compromise your sleep
Giving rest to your brain is the least thing you can do. Sleep for at least eight hours straight. Sleep recovers your mind and when you wake up after a goodnight sleep you are a new person in a new day having many new thoughts and ideas.
